The Perfect Blend of Art and Science

 

This video showcases a tiny sample of the things you'll see at the Explorarorium.

I've been a fan of the San Francisco Exploratorium for years. What a brilliant idea! Give artists an opportunity to illustrate principles of science - and do it in the form of play. I was able to get a look at the newest set of exhibits, GLOW, running through January of 2022 - light, color, and learning. Of course, all my favorites in the Tinkering section were there, especially Diesel Punk Pegasus.

Don't make the mistake of thinking the Exploratorium is just for kids and families. There are After Dark memberships for adults that are date night favorites. All the exhibits have an element of hand-on play, and there are dozens of them from the ephemeral to the biological. Don't miss it!

Bouquets to Art at the Legion


Besides being a repository for some stunning works of art, the Legion of Honor Art and Sculpture Museum of San Francisco features events throughout the year.


 In the spring, the  Legion invites floral artists to work with a painting or sculpture from their extensive classical collection, and to construct a living compliment to the artwork. The opening days of the exhibit are always packed, but if you can wait a few days, the flowers and accompanying materials are still fresh and lovely--and you'll actually be able to see the art and floral displays at the same time.The artwork on display ranges from antiquity to the early 20th century, and the florals reflect the color, shape and intent of each work.
